| EVALUATION OF Sapindus trifoliatus ON ALZHEIMER'S DISEASE INDUCED BY ALUMINUM CHLORIDE IN RATS | | NIM BAHADUR DANGI, B.SREEDHAR NAIK, S.NAGARJUNA, ANIL SHRESTHA, HARI PRASAD SAPKOTA AND NABIN WAGLE | | DOI: | | Abstract: The present study aimed to investigate the possible prophylactic and therapeutic effects of hydro-alcoholic extract of Sapindus trifoliatus on AD induced by AlCl3 in rats. In this study thirty adult Wistar albino rats were selected and were divided into 5 groups (six each). Group I, II, III, IV & V served as normal control, negative control, test group and standard control respectively. The rats were given treatment for 30 days and behavioural parameters were determined on 1st, 10th, 20th, &30th day of treatment. After day 30th rats were sacrificed and biochemical parameters (antioxidant levels & Acetylcholinesterase activity) were determined. This study indicated that Sapindus trifoliatus when was used for treatment of AlCl3induced AD, it improves the behavioural & biochemical parameters. The histopathological finding in hippocampus of brain tissue neuron appears less or more like normal one when compared to the negative control | | Keywords: Acetylcholine, Acetylcholinesterase, Sapindus trifoliatus, Morris water maze, passive avoidance test, Y-maze |
